Did you know that during the 1940s, many pinball manufacturers shifted production to support the war effort during World War II? Companies that normally built pinball machines began producing military equipment and parts instead. After the war ended, pinball returned stronger than ever, becoming one of America's favorite forms of entertainment throughout the 1950s and beyond.

🎯 PINBALL FUN FACT OF THE DAY 🎯

Did you know pinball was once banned in major cities across America because people thought it was gambling? Everything changed when flippers were added, proving pinball was a true game of skill!

Today, vintage pinball machines are some of the most collectible arcade games in the world, loved by retro gaming fans, collectors, restorers, and competitive players alike.

🎯 PINBALL FUN FACT OF THE DAY 🎯

Did you know the first pinball machines didn’t even have flippers? 🤯

Early pinball games in the 1930s were more like tabletop gambling machines where players simply launched the ball and hoped for the best. It wasn’t until 1947 that flippers were introduced, completely changing the game forever and turning pinball into the fast-paced skill game we know today! ⚡

The first machine with flippers was called Humpty Dumpty by Gottlieb — and it featured SIX flippers! 🎉
